Hormone replacement therapy and lipid-lipoprotein concentrations.

Summary
Hormone replacement therapy, including estrogen-only and combined formulations, improved lipid profiles in postmenopausal women. Estrogen therapy positively impacted cholesterol and triglyceride levels, enhancing overall cardiovascular health markers.
Area of Science:
- Endocrinology and Metabolism
- Cardiovascular Health
- Women's Health
Background:
- Menopause is associated with changes in lipid profiles, increasing cardiovascular risk.
- Hormone replacement therapy (HRT) is a common intervention for menopausal symptoms.
- Understanding HRT's impact on lipids is crucial for cardiovascular disease prevention.
Purpose of the Study:
- To investigate the association between HRT and lipid-lipoprotein concentrations in postmenopausal women.
- To compare the effects of different HRT formulations on lipid profiles.
- To evaluate long-term lipid changes over seven years of HRT.
Main Methods:
- An open prospective longitudinal study involving 6416 postmenopausal women.
- Participants received either estrogen-only therapy (conjugated equine estrogen [CEE] or transdermal estradiol [TDE2]) or combined estrogen-progestin therapy.
- Lipid-lipoprotein concentrations (total cholesterol, triglycerides, HDL-C, LDL-C, VLDL-C) were measured annually and cumulatively.
Main Results:
- Estrogen-only therapy significantly decreased total cholesterol, LDL-C, and VLDL-C, while increasing HDL-C.
- Transdermal estradiol (TDE2) showed a less pronounced increase in HDL-C and triglycerides compared to CEE.
- Combined estrogen-progestin therapy generally improved lipid profiles, with some formulations showing decreased triglycerides and VLDL.
Conclusions:
- Both estrogen-only and combined HRT formulations lead to more favorable lipid profiles in postmenopausal women.
- HRT can be an effective strategy for managing dyslipidemia in menopausal women.
- The choice of HRT formulation may influence the extent of lipid profile modification.
